Essential Ingredients
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:
- Mashed Potatoes: Use freshly made or leftover mashed potatoes for a creamy base; ensure they are smooth without lumps.
- Shredded Cheese: A blend of sharp cheddar and mozzarella works wonders; choose your favorite cheese for personalized flavor.
- Eggs: Two large eggs help bind everything together; use room temperature eggs for best results.
- Breadcrumbs: Fresh breadcrumbs add crunch; consider using seasoned ones for extra flavor.
- Green Onions: Chopped green onions brighten up the flavor; feel free to substitute with chives if preferred.
- Salt and Pepper: Essential seasonings elevate all flavors; adjust according to taste preferences.
- Cooking Oil: Canola or vegetable oil is ideal for frying; ensure it’s hot enough before adding puffs for ultimate crispiness.

Let’s Make it Together
Prep Your Ingredients: Gather all your ingredients on the counter for an organized cooking session.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C) while you prepare your mixture.
Mix Everything Together: In a large mixing bowl, combine mashed potatoes, shredded cheese, eggs, breadcrumbs, salt, pepper, and chopped green onions until well blended.
Scoop Your Mixture: Using a spoon or cookie scoop, portion out small amounts of the mixture onto a parchment-lined baking sheet. Keep them about two inches apart.
Shape and Coat Each Puff: Gently roll each portion into balls before coating them in additional breadcrumbs for that extra crunch factor.
Fry Those Puffs: Heat oil in a deep skillet over medium heat until shimmering. Carefully add puffs in batches and fry until golden brown on all sides—about 4-5 minutes.
Drain and Serve Hot: Remove the puffs from oil using a slotted spoon and let them drain on paper towels. Serve immediately while they are still warm and gooey inside!

Add Your Touch
Feel free to swap out cheddar cheese for gouda or add in some crispy bacon bits for extra flavor. Fresh herbs like chives or parsley can also elevate the dish further.
Storing & Reheating
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. To reheat, pop them back in a preheated oven at 350°F until warmed through and crispy again.

FAQ
Can I use instant mashed potatoes for Cheesy Mashed Potato Puffs?
Yes, but real mashed potatoes provide better flavor and texture in this recipe.
How do I make my puffs extra cheesy?
Add more cheese directly into the potato mixture before shaping into puffs.
What dipping sauces pair well with Cheesy Mashed Potato Puffs?
Ranch dressing or spicy ketchup complement these cheesy delights perfectly, adding zest!

Cheesy Mashed Potato Puffs
- Total Time: 30 minutes
- Yield: Approximately 24 servings 1x
Description
Cheesy Mashed Potato Puffs are crispy bites filled with creamy cheese, perfect for parties or as a cozy snack.
Ingredients
- 2 cups mashed potatoes (smooth)
- 1 cup shredded sharp cheddar cheese
- 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
- 2 large eggs (room temperature)
- 1 cup fresh breadcrumbs
- 1/4 cup chopped green onions (or chives)
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Cooking oil for frying
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
- In a large bowl, combine mashed potatoes, cheddar cheese, mozzarella cheese, eggs, breadcrumbs, green onions, salt, and pepper. Mix until well blended.
- Scoop small portions onto a parchment-lined baking sheet, spacing them about two inches apart.
- Roll each portion into a ball and coat in additional breadcrumbs.
- Heat oil in a deep skillet over medium heat until shimmering. Fry the puffs in batches until golden brown on all sides, about 4-5 minutes.
- Drain on paper towels and serve warm.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 15 minutes
- Category: Appetizer
- Method: Frying
- Cuisine: American
